#000bbc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#000bbc is composed of 0% red, 4.3%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 94.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 236.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 36.9%. #000bbc color hex could be obtained by blending #0016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#000bbc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#000bbc has RGB values of R:0, G:11, B:188 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 3004.

Shades and Tints of #000bbc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010b is the darkest color, while #f7f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#000bbc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575865 is the less saturated color, while #000bbc is the most saturated one.
